Popular Streaming Platforms
- ESPN+: ESPN+ often carries a variety of rugby matches, including international fixtures and club competitions. It is known for its extensive sports coverage, so it is a good option. The subscription fees are reasonable, and you will get access to a lot of sports content in addition to rugby. Make sure to check their schedule. The ease of access, combined with its affordability, makes it a popular choice for many rugby fans. Ensure you have a stable internet connection for the best viewing experience.
- FloSports: FloSports is another great option, with a specific focus on a variety of sports. They regularly stream rugby matches, making them a great choice. You may need a paid subscription to access live games. They often provide multiple camera angles and replays. FloSports offers a comprehensive viewing experience for rugby fans. You’ll find it’s a solid platform to consider if you're serious about your rugby viewing.
- RugbyPass: RugbyPass is an excellent choice if you're a dedicated rugby fan. It provides an extensive library of games, documentaries, and highlights from around the world. It may have specific coverage for your region. RugbyPass offers a complete rugby experience. If you’re serious about rugby, it's worth considering. They often have exclusive content and in-depth analysis. It's an excellent way to dive deep into the world of rugby. This is a top-tier destination for where to watch Japan vs. Uruguay rugby.
- Local and International Broadcasters: Check your local sports channels or international sports networks. Sometimes, the game will be broadcast live on these channels. This is an easy way to watch. Often, these channels have commentary and analysis of the matches.

Major Sports Channels
- ESPN: ESPN is a go-to channel for sports fans, often broadcasting major rugby matches. Check your local ESPN channel for the game. ESPN often provides extensive coverage, including pre-game analysis, commentary, and post-game discussions. They also have highlights and replays. ESPN is a very reliable option for catching the match. It's often included in basic cable packages.
- beIN SPORTS: beIN SPORTS is another excellent channel. They regularly broadcast international rugby matches. They provide extensive coverage of global sports events. If you have this channel, then the answer to where to watch Japan vs. Uruguay rugby becomes much simpler.
- Local Sports Networks: Regional sports networks may also broadcast rugby matches. Check your local listings to see if the game is available in your area. These networks can offer tailored coverage to your region. Local sports networks often have insightful commentary from regional experts.
